区块链的起源和原理解析
区块链是一种去中心化的分布式账本技术,通过密码学和共识算法保证数据的安全和可信,并实现了交易的透明和不可篡改。它的起源可以追溯到2008年,由一位或一组隐藏身份的人使用化名“中本聪”发表了《比特币白皮书》。本文将深入解析区块链的起源和原理。
1. 区块链的起源
区块链的起源可以说是与比特币密不可分。比特币是一种基于区块链技术的去中心化电子货币,而区块链则是比特币的底层技术基础。2008年,一个或一组隐藏身份的人以化名“中本聪”发表了《比特币白皮书》,提出了一种去中心化的数字货币系统,这标志着区块链的诞生。
2. 区块链的原理
区块链的原理主要包括分布式账本、密码学和共识机制。
2.1 分布式账本
区块链采用分布式账本的方式,将数据存储在不同节点的计算机上。每个节点都有完整的账本副本,并且可以验证其他节点的数据的合法性。这种去中心化的存储方式保证了数据的安全性和可信度。
2.2 密码学
密码学是区块链的核心技术之一。区块链使用密码学算法进行数据的加密和解密,以保证数据的安全性。其中,哈希函数、非对称加密和数字签名等技术被广泛应用。哈希函数用于给数据生成唯一的摘要,非对称加密用于加密和解密数据,数字签名用于验证数据的真实性和完整性。
2.3 共识机制
区块链中的共识机制用于解决分布式环境下的数据一致性和信任问题。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、拜占庭容错(BFT)等。其中,PoW是比特币所采用的机制,它通过计算量大的工作来竞争记账权,确保数据按照时间顺序被添加到区块链中。
3. 区块链的应用领域
区块链技术具有很大的潜力,正在被广泛应用于各个行业。以下是几个区块链的应用领域:
3.1 金融行业
区块链可以用于构建安全、高效的支付和结算系统,提高交易速度和降低成本。通过智能合约,可以实现自动化的金融产品和服务。
3.2 物流行业
区块链可以提高物流信息的透明度和追溯性,确保供应链的可信度。通过智能合约,可以自动实现物流合同和支付等过程。
3.3 医疗行业
区块链可以加强医疗数据的安全性和隐私保护,实现医疗数据的共享和跨机构查询。通过智能合约,可以实现精准医疗和医疗资源的优化配置。
4. 发展趋势和展望
区块链技术在过去几年取得
版权声明:本文为 “联成科技技术有限公司” 原创文章,转载请附上原文出处链接及本声明;